Section Info: South County Senior Center | A range of healing arts topics will be covered including alternative, complementary, holistic, integrative, mind-body, wellness, and world medicine. An overview of natural health foods, specialized diets and nutritional supplements is covered. Also included are self-healing practices of mindfulness meditation, journaling, reflective writing, plus intuitive and creative arts. Subtle energy therapies covered include homeopathy, herbs, essential oils, aroma therapy, acupuncture, bodywork and hands healing, plus Yoga, Tai Chi, Qigong, and subtle energy movement exercise practices.

Section Info: Severn Senior Center | Qigong | Explore the health benefits of Qi Gong, an ancient Chinese practice that cultivates energy through movement and breath. This class focuses on the Eight Pieces of Brocade, promoting flexibility, relaxation, mental clarity, and vitality. Gentle movements help calm the mind, energize the body, and support overall balance and wellbeing.

Section Info: South County Senior Center | Mat Yoga | No class July 31 | Practiced primarily on the mat, this class focuses on slow, controlled movements, mindful breathing, and simple poses that are accessible for all experience levels. Participants will be guided through a series of stretches, strengthening exercises, and relaxation techniques that help reduce stiffness, ease joint discomfort, and enhance mobility. Movements can be adapted to individual abilities making it ideal for anyone. The emphasis is on comfort, safety, and listening to your body while enjoying the benefits of mindful movement.
